Red Fruit Compote Tiramisu

Ingredients for 6 servings:

  • 1 pack of ladyfingers
  • 500 g red fruit compote
  • 3 tbsp cherry brandy
  • 250 g mascarpone
  • 300 g yogurt (3.5% fat)
  • 2 tbsp powdered sugar

Instructions

Working time approx. 15 minutes; Rest time approx. 12 hours; Total time approx. 12 hours 15 minutes

for guests, easy, fast

Place the sponge fingers in a baking dish, covering the entire bottom (I had a few leftovers). Mix the ready-made red fruit compote from the supermarket with 3 tablespoons of cherry brandy, stir well, and pour over the sponge fingers. Whisk the mascarpone with yogurt and 2-3 tablespoons of powdered sugar (depending on how sweet you want it) until creamy. Spread this cream on the sponge fingers. Cover everything with plastic wrap or a lid and refrigerate overnight. This will allow the sponge fingers to set and become nice and soft. Theoretically, this will keep for 3-4 days if kept cool.
